Consider the following statements: 1. Some microorganisms can grow in environments with temperature above the boiling point of water. 2. Some microorganisms can grow in environments with temperature below the freezing point of water. 3. Some microorganisms can grow in highly acidic environment with a pH below 3. How many of the above statements are correct?
  1. A. Only one
  2. B. Only two
  3. C. All three
  4. D. None

Answer: C

Explanation

1. Statement 1 is correct: Thermophilic and hyperthermophilic microorganisms, particularly archaea, can thrive in extremely hot environments. For example, Pyrolobus fumarii can grow at temperatures up to 113°C, well above the boiling point of water. 2. Statement 2 is correct: Psychrophilic or cryophilic microorganisms are extremophiles that can grow and reproduce in cold temperatures, including those below the freezing point of water (e.g., in polar regions or deep-sea environments). 3. Statement 3 is correct: Acidophilic microorganisms are adapted to highly acidic conditions. Extreme acidophiles can grow optimally at pH values below 3, found in environments like acid mine drainage or volcanic hot springs. Therefore, all three statements are correct.
